In fact most airline pilots are trained to reduce airspeed when the winds are so much … WebWind speed and direction. At flight altitude the wind can reach speeds of 200 km/h or more. This might seem as hurricane levels. However, since the density of the air decreases with the altitude, the force done by this wind on the plane is smaller than at ground level. Web25 apr. 2024 · Jet streams blow in narrow bands with widths of a few hundred miles and thicknesses of less than 3 miles. They typically average 160 to 240 kilometers per hour (100 to 150 miles per hour) in summer, and they can reach speeds of 400 kilometers per hour (250 miles per hour) in winter.
